Python 文件命名规范最佳实践204
在 Python 中,遵循明确的文件命名规范至关重要,因为它有助于保持代码库的整洁性和可读性。通过采用一致的命名惯例,开发人员可以轻松地定位和理解代码文件,从而提高团队合作和代码维护效率。## 命名规则
Python 文件命名应遵循以下一般规则:* 使用小写字母并用下划线分隔单词,例如 ``。
* 避免使用缩写或首字母缩略词,因为它们难以理解。
* 文件名应清楚地描述文件的内容和用途。
* 保持命名约定的一致性,以确保整个代码库的统一性。
## 模块和包
模块是 Python 中代码组织的基本单位。它们通常包含一组相关的函数、类和变量。模块文件应以 `.py` 扩展名命名,并与模块名称相同。例如,名为 `my_module` 的模块应保存在文件 `` 中。
包是包含多个模块的目录。包名称应遵循与模块相同的命名规则。包目录应包含一个名为 `` 的特殊文件,该文件指示 Python 这是一个包。例如,名为 `my_package` 的包应包含目录 `my_package` 和文件 `my_package/`。## 测试文件
测试文件用于验证 Python 代码的正确性。它们应以 `test_` 前缀命名,后跟要测试的模块或包的名称。例如,测试 `my_module` 模块的测试文件应命名为 ``。## 文档和示例
文档和示例文件通常包含有关 Python 代码的附加信息。它们应以描述性文件名命名,清楚地表明其内容。例如:
- ``:包含 `my_module` 模块的文档。
- ``: 展示 `my_module` 模块如何使用的示例。## 保持一致性
保持文件命名规范的一致性对于有效管理 Python 代码库至关重要。通过遵循明确的规则,开发人员可以确保整个团队使用统一的命名约定。这将提高可读性、可维护性和代码协作的整体质量。## Python 官方指南
有关 Python 文件命名规范的更多详细信息,请参阅 Python 官方指南:- [Python 文件命名规范](/dev/peps/pep-0008/)
2024-10-19
上一篇:Python字符串逆序输出
C语言字符输出深度解析:从基础函数到高级技巧与实践
https://www.shuihudhg.cn/133309.html
Python代码自动化替换:从文本到抽象语法树的深度解析与实践
https://www.shuihudhg.cn/133308.html
Python实现矩阵逆运算:从原理到高效实践的全面指南
https://www.shuihudhg.cn/133307.html
Java集成Kafka:深度解析与实践获取消息数据
https://www.shuihudhg.cn/133306.html
PHP 操作 SQLite 数据库:从入门到实践的完整指南
https://www.shuihudhg.cn/133305.html
热门文章
Python 格式化字符串
https://www.shuihudhg.cn/1272.html
Python 函数库:强大的工具箱,提升编程效率
https://www.shuihudhg.cn/3366.html
Python向CSV文件写入数据
https://www.shuihudhg.cn/372.html
Python 静态代码分析:提升代码质量的利器
https://www.shuihudhg.cn/4753.html
Python 文件名命名规范:最佳实践
https://www.shuihudhg.cn/5836.html